A self-starting siphon
Secure a piece of glass or plastic tube about 2.5 cm in diameter and 8 to 10 cm in length. Fit single end with a one-hole stopper, carrying a short length of glass tube that extends about a centimetre under the stopper on the inner side. Fit the other end of the large tube with a two-hole stopper. By one of the holes in the two-hole stopper place a jet tube which extends up by the larger tube and into the opening of the glass tube in the one-hole stopper. Connect a long rubber tube to the glass tube in the single-hole stopper
